sailor

/ˈseɪlə/ · noun

Meaning

  1. A person in the business of navigating ships or other vessels
  2. Someone knowledgeable in the practical management of ships.
  3. A member of the crew of a vessel; a mariner; a common seaman.
  4. A person who sails sailing boats as a sport or recreation.
  5. Any of various nymphalid butterflies of the genera Neptis, Pseudoneptis and Phaedyma, having white markings on a dark base and commonly flying by gliding.
